java输出598年到2017年所有的闰年
时间: 2024-06-15 15:04:46 浏览: 146
JAVA经典100例
要输出598年到2017年之间的所有闰年,可以使用以下Java代码:
```java
public class LeapYear {
public static void main(String[] args) {
for (int year = 598; year <= 2017; year++) {
if (isLeapYear(year)) {
System.out.println(year);
}
}
}
public static boolean isLeapYear(int year) {
if (year % 4 != 0) {
return false;
} else if (year % 100 != 0) {
return true;
} else if (year % 400 != 0) {
return false;
} else {
return true;
}
}
}
```
这段代码定义了一个`LeapYear`类,其中的`main`方法用于输出598年到2017年之间的所有闰年。`isLeapYear`方法用于判断一个年份是否为闰年,根据闰年的定义进行判断。
阅读全文